I picked one up last month in a different color and have been really enjoying it, the neck feels great and begs to be played. Out of the box it played well, the Mustang saddle style bridge is good, no issues with strings slipping, I had to adjust the truss rod, trem spring tension and bridge height to my preference then fine tune the intonation a bit, after that I'd consider it gig ready.

Hey, the build quality of the original guitar as it came from squier was OK, its about what you'd expect from the bullet series if you have experience with those.

Nothing amazing but functionally everything worked without major issue, was able to set it up and played it that way for about a month before gutting it.

I can confirm the body is indeed lighter and thinner than a standard Fender body. The guitar assembled is only about 6.5lbs. I'm sure you could find a baritone neck to fit the body, but you might (or probably) have a bit of neck dive.

If I knew the extent of modding I was going to end up doing with the neck, pickups, pickguard, tuners, and all I replaced I'm not sure I would get a $200 whole guitar to basically use just the top load bridge and body off it. That said, finding a HT strat body can be a pita, and it's an easy top load HT to find.

What is this configuration good for? I think for Tom Delonge it was a simplicity thing, one pickup and one volume pot was easier for him live without the volume pot getting in the way of his strumming. For me, its fun, I just find it incredibly fun to play a loud single humbucker guitar.

As far as what does it do for the sound, without a neck pickup there isn't an additional magnetic field so the strings can ring out more in theory. Some say it helps with dynamics and sustain. Not having the other tone pot and extra wiring can have some impact on the tone, I think because less wiring and resistance from the other pot, but I'm not an expert.

While a single humbucker guitar may not cover quite the same sonic range as multiple pickup guitars they still can be quite versatile with just a volume and tone pot (this guitar doesn't have the tone pot anymore but the stock configuration did), having just one pickup kind of forces you to adapt too.

The Seymour Duncan Invader humbucker in the TD style strats are high output and fairly bright, they respond extremely well to dynamics/pick attack, great for chugging. They are best suited for modern rock, punk, metal, but probably manage other genres too.

Word of caution, replacing strings with a different gauge on an acoustic will generally require a new "setup", truss rod adjusted, possibly nut filed, etc.

If you aren't comfortable doing that, I'd recommend replacing with the same gauge the guitar is currently "setup" for (that being from the factory or a luthier).
